The club has thrived this year and has been involved several leagues as well as providing individual athletes to represent Great Britain at all ages including under 17 and Masters. 

The trustees have urged the management committee to look at the rather lengthy waiting list for the younger athletes and indeed there have been great strides in this regard. 

The trustees regularly review the policies in place for the club. These policies were improved very recently and so the task of reviewing those policies has been much reduced. There will be changes of trustees at the February 2025 AGM due to 1 of the trustees becoming the chairman of the club. The trustees are confident that the financial controls in place and the efficiency of the Treasurer and membership secretary is very reassuring. 

The trustees approved the accounts before they were adopted at the AGM although expenditure seeded income by £4000 this was budgeted for due to the costs of improving the track trustees always conscious of the level of reserves and are pleased that steps are being taken to improve the amenities for the club membership of 1000 members.
